//-------------------------------------------------------------------- // name: LiSa-trigger.ck // desc: Live sampling utilities for ChucK // // author: Dan Trueman, 2007 // // based on the S.M.E.L.T. (http://smelt.cs.princeton.edu/) envelope // follower trigger program will trigger start and stop to one-shot // LiSa buffers. a sort of triggered delay line, so the delays follow // the player rather than being static. Success depends on tuning the // envelope follower closely to the input gains on however you are // getting audio into ChucK.
